How to choose the right print
Two questions are enough: where will they hang it, and what size makes sense?
For a hallway, a bedroom or an entrance, 30 × 40 cm is ideal — present without dominating. For a living room or a main wall, a large size (50 × 70 cm or 43.2 × 63.2 cm) has real presence, the kind you notice as soon as you walk in.
Style matters too: in a pared-back interior, a clear composition holds better; in a house full of life, a richer image keeps revealing details over the years.
